My first card, I had to die cut allllll the colors. NO joke–You should see my pile–I die cut for over an hour 😄! I just wanted everything ready and available to tinker around with. So glad I did!

I decided to design my pattern in the same color order, but I went in columns and snaked it back up and down. So in the end, it looks random, but if you really stop and look, you’ll see I went in the same order. I have always loved those scrap quilts people make and this has a bit of that random feel to me–albeit all cut the same 😉.

The sentiments are from Simple Strips-Crafty (so fitting, right?)and from Mini Strips- Hello Add Ons. OH and I used the Pierced Grid Cutting Plate die (you can purchase separately) as my background–I will be using this one often! Love that subtle texture!

Next up, I used one of the Maps in the kit to create this card with Tropical Punch, Dijon and Raspberry Sorbet!

Different than I would normally whip up, but I thought it had that homey, cozy feel! The TE Maps – Pieced Patterns in the kit really make this QUICK to do and quite cathartic! The trick is to have all your pieces cut and just have fun putting the puzzle together! 🙂

The Hello is from Big Hello and the Simple Strip is Simple Strips – Crafty again. I wish I was under this “quilt” right now! 🙂

Here’s the scoop from TE:

The Pieced Patterns Cardmaking Kit retails for $57, is packaged in a zippered pouch with a custom sticker, and includes:
  • Pieced Patterns – Squares die
  • Pieced Patterns – Triangles die
  • Four Square 6×6 Background stamp
  • Sticky Sheets (set of 10 sheets)
  • TE Maps – Pieced Patterns
  • The Insiders – Everyday Occasions panels
  • True Colors Inspiration Cards (set of 4)
Most kit items are not available to purchase individually.
Additional products available to purchase outside of the kit: Pierced Grid Cutting Plate die, Pieced Patterns envelope seals (set of 10, 5 each of 2 designs), TE Maps – Pieced Patterns, and The Insiders – Everyday Occasions panels.

Limited quantity available.
